So, this is not for everyone. This targets Linux users that have a freedesktop spec compliant file manager… (so not KDE )
I have made a little tool that helps identify homebrew in the file manager.
Maybe this will be useful for someone (or be included in some Switch Linux distribution).

It depends on 'freeimage' library and `shared-mime-info' system.
In the future I plan to overlay the embedded version info in the generated thumbnail, so it will be even easier to distinguish different releases.
